⑴ 前端限制郵箱長度
是限制的。
郵件參數一般需要配置如用戶名、密碼、郵件地址,顯示名稱,以及其他郵件所需的必要配置,一般我們可以通過界面管理的方式進行常規的參數配置。
前端表單內容不能為空,兩次注冊密碼必須一致,電話號碼必須為11位,郵箱限制格式。
⑵ web前端需要掌握的哪些知識
一個合格的web前端需要掌握哪些技術?
最基礎的自然是JavaScript,HTML和css這三種語言。
首先了解下它們到底是什麼。
HTML是用戶看到的網頁的骨架,比如你會發現當前頁面分為左中右三個部分,其中還填充了不同的文字和圖片;每個子部分還會繼續細分,比如當前頁面的中間部分下方有輸入框等等。
CSS是網頁展示的細節控制,比如你會發現有的文字是紅底白色,有的子部分佔了頁面的二分之一寬,有的只佔六分之一,有些部分需要用戶進行某些操作(如點擊,滑動)才會出現等等,這些就是有CSS來控制。
JavaScript是負責捕捉用戶在瀏覽器上的操作,並與後端伺服器進行數據交換的腳本語言。當用戶在前端進行點擊,輸入等操作的時候,會觸動綁定了該動作的JavaScript腳本,然後JavaScript收集數據,調用後端的api介面,再將後端返回的數據交給HTML和CSS渲染出來。
一個網頁的HTML代碼和CSS代碼是可以直接在瀏覽器中查看的,你可以直接按F12,就能看到下圖右側的模塊,左右側紅框就是代碼與實際頁面的對應關系。因此如果你看到某個網站的布局很不錯,不妨點擊F12,進行學習。
前端框架
然而,實際應用中,已經很少有正規的項目組直接用上述三種語言進行web 前端開發了,而是使用很多封裝了這三種語言的框架,比如
Vue.js
,angular,react native等等。它們是來自谷歌和Facebook的大神項目組,基於自己的經驗,封裝了原生前端語言,實現了更多更復雜更酷炫的功能。因此,可以說,學會使用這些框架,能達到事半功倍的效果。
比如用了vue,它是自底向上增量開發的設計,其核心只關心圖層,而且還可以與其他庫或已存項目融合,學習門檻極其友好;另一方面,vue可以驅動單文件組件和vue生態系統支持的庫開發的復雜單頁應用。有了這個生態系統,可以說,vue是處在一個不斷壯大,不斷完善的欣欣向榮的狀態。
網路通信協議
由於前後端分離的趨勢,前端還需要了解很多網路通信協議的知識,這里不局限於http協議,因為據我的經驗,有時候我們還會用到websocket等協議。因此,前端需要簡單了解不同協議的特點以及使用方式,但是好消息是不用像學習計算機網路課程一樣對每種協議的原理都了解的特別透徹,只要學會如何用前端語言發送這種協議的請求就夠了。
⑶ 網站頁面長度過長 SEOre該如何優化提高收錄
日常網站seo優化過程中,我們首先考慮的是什麼?可能很多站長和seo工程師會先考慮如何優化網站的TDK,也就是標簽、描述、關鍵詞這三項,然後再針對性的進行外鏈和內鏈的相關優化。認為做好這些,把頁面做的漂亮,然後有效的增加優質內容,便可以提高收錄。這些seo基本的常識確實沒錯,然而在重視網站TDK屬性、內外鏈、優質內容的同時,我們也往往會忽略一些平時很難直接注意到的要素,從而導致網站明明看起來做的不錯,但是收錄效果卻不理想。那麼問題究竟出在哪裡呢?今天在這里,筆者要跟大家分享的是網站頁面長度過長導致的不收錄的反面案例。
網站頁面代碼長度對收錄的影響
此前在網路站長平台的站長學院中,網路官方的工程師分享了這樣一個案例,一個網站主題內容由js生成,沒有對用戶訪問做優化,但是對搜索引擎爬蟲做了很多有針對性的優化,表面看起來十分完美,但是卻沒有被網路收錄。究其原因發現,這個網站將圖片二進制內容直接放到了html中,導致頁面長度過長,從而沒有被網路收錄。可能很多站長看了這個案例會納悶,做了好多年網站,還從沒遇到這樣的案例。難道頁面長度也是影響網站收錄的重要因素嗎。
分析這個問題,首先我們要了解什麼是網站頁面長度。這里所謂的頁面長度並非直觀意義上瀏覽網站頁面所看到的長度。而是指的頁面代碼長度。一般的網站,都會將圖片的鏈接或者路徑直接加到html代碼中,對頁面長度沒有太大影響,而這個網站的案例並不多見,它直接將圖片的二進制內容放到html代碼中,也就是直接使用了編碼,才導致了網站不收錄的情況。
網路站長平台給出的分析原因:
1、網站針對爬蟲爬取做的優化,直接將圖片二進制內容放到了html中導致頁面長度過長,網站頁面長度達164k;
2、 站點優化後將主體內容放於最後,圖片卻放於前面;
3、爬蟲抓取內容後,頁面內容過長被截斷,已抓取部分無法識別到主體內容,最終導致頁面被認定為空短而不收錄。
工程師建議:
1、不建議站點使用js生成主體內容,如js渲染出錯,很可能導致頁面內容讀取錯誤,頁面無法抓取
2、 如站點針對爬蟲爬取做優化,建議頁面長度在128k之內,不要過長
3、針對爬蟲爬取做優化,請將主體內容放於前方,避免抓取截斷造成的內容抓取不全
其實這個問題,一般網站都不會出現,只是極少數網站會採用如此不合理的頁面優化方式。不過也給廣大網站提了個醒,在平時優化網站時,頁面長度也是衡量一個頁面質量能否被收錄的主要因素之一。
網站前端和內容上,頁面過長是否影響收錄?
分析完了網站頁面長度導致不收錄的原因,可能有人要問,我的網站頁面長度都控制在合理范圍內,也不是js生成的主題內容,為什麼收錄效果還是一般。這個問題,就要考慮網站前端頁面的設計,以及內容長度上對於收錄的影響了。在這里,筆者也給出了一下幾點建議:
1、文章建議設置摘要欄,並且不建議文章開頭使用圖片。現在很多網站的文章,都會設置摘要。一般摘要不易過長,大概50-100個字即可。這樣不僅提高了用戶的閱讀體驗,對於搜索引擎抓取也起到了很好的促進作用。像網路,就比較喜歡摘要設置合理的文章內容。現在有很多網站,在發布內容時,喜歡配圖。圖文結合的文章確實有利於閱讀,也受搜索引擎歡迎。但是如果正文以圖片開頭的話,網路首先抓取到的是圖片,然後再抓取內容,這樣的文章其實是不利於抓取的。所以建議將圖文放置在文章中間的位置,並且設置摘要,這樣的內容才是搜索引擎最喜歡抓取的樣式。
2、文章過長建議設置分頁。現在很多網站喜歡發長文,有的網站設置了分頁,而有的網站則是一拉到底,內容很長。不僅不利於用戶閱讀,搜索引擎爬蟲也不喜歡這樣的文章。太長,用戶一直要下拉滾動條,如果圖片太多,還會影響載入速度。同理,搜索引擎爬蟲也存在抓取困難的問題。久而久之,便會降低對網站的內容評價,影響收錄。
3、頻道欄目頁文章不宜設置過多條數。現在的頻道欄目頁圖文摘要的形式成為主流,進而增加了頁面下拉的長度。如果設置過長,用戶瀏覽體驗不佳,更不利於搜索引擎爬蟲抓取。頻道欄目頁的顯示條數,宜設置在30條左右。此前筆者的網站設置了每頁顯示50條,普遍用戶反映不方便瀏覽。通過測試,網路抓取的效果也不是很理想。頻道欄目的文章摘要,也應該統一為固定的字數,50-100字最佳。因為規范的圖片和摘要,也是搜索引擎爬蟲抓取衡量網站質量的重要因素。能夠手動設置最好,因為在摘要中手動設置適當的關鍵詞,也有利於頁面和文章的收錄。
⑷ 前端的寬度與長度採用百分比好還是具體值好
這個你得按照設計稿來做,如果設計稿設計的是自動縮放的,那就用百分比,如果是固定尺寸那就用PX。
⑸ Web前端新手應該知道的CSS長度單位
今天小編要跟大家分享的文章是關於Web前端新手應該知道的CSS長度單位!眾所周知CSS技術我們雖然很熟悉,在使用的過程卻很容易被困住,這讓我們在新問題出現的時候變得很不利。隨著web繼續不斷地發展,對於新技術新解決方案的要求也會不斷增長。
因此,作為網頁設計師和前端開發人員,我們別無選擇,必須熟悉我們手上的工具,做到知己知彼,這樣才能百戰不殆。為了幫助大家更好的工作小編今天為大家分享一些css的長度單位,希望能夠對小夥伴們有所幫助。
1、rem
我們首先介紹下和我們熟悉的很相似的貨。em
被定義為相對於當前對象內文本的字體大小。炒個栗子,如果你給body小哥設置了font-size字體大小,那麼body小哥的任何子元素的1em就是等於body設置的font-size。
Test
⑹ JS怎麼控制文本框輸入的長度
JS控制文本框輸入的長度的方法如下:
1、html頁面中有以下文本:
<input id="groupidtext" type="text" style="width: 100px;" maxlength="6" /></td>
2、用js限制輸入的最大長度的腳本如下:
$(function)
$('#groupidtext').on{'input', function(e)}
if(this.value.length === 6) { //如果輸入長度等於6,則禁用輸入}
$('input[type="submit"]').prop('disabled', false);
else
$('input[type="submit"]').prop('disabled', true);
js限制文本框輸入的長度為18位字元, 只能是數字和字母,如果輸入的字元超過18位就不能在輸入了。
⑺ 前端控制的原則
前端控制是現代文件管理理念之一,即在文件形成之時就介入其質量控制。按文件生命周期劃分階段,地質資料的「形成」之時是前端,「鑒定、整理、編目、入庫、借閱」等具體操作為中端,「銷毀」是末端。在紙質載體檔案管理中,傳統上稱歸檔前的為科技文件材料,歸檔後稱地質資料。科技文件材料的產生是在工程作業現場或地質研究場所,特別是在勘探開發工程作業現場,首先接觸到地質科技文件材料的是負責生產管理的工程技術人員。現場記錄的文字與數據就產生於現場技術人員之手,在沒有移交資料管理人員之前,就是他們管理著地質科技文件材料,也就是他們處在地質資料管理的前端。電子文件和數據採集也出自他們的工作過程。前端控制是全程管理的重要前提。地質資料管理的前端控制概念是20世紀後期提出來的。有人懷疑前端控制,認為這超出地質資料管理工作范圍,有越位之嫌。但作者認為前端控制有以下的必要性:
(一)是保證資料真實可靠、完整規范、可識別的前提
各類地質報告在形成初期,文字材料有初稿、二稿和終稿之分,電子文件也具有易流失、易刪改特性,很容易出現差錯,在源頭出現差錯若不能及時發現和改正,這件地質資料質量就沒有保證,運用於指導勘探工程,不但造成工程時間上的不可彌補,探礦工程的經費損失也是非常大的。若錯了的勘探數據信息,沒有被發現,用來誤導接下來的處理、解釋和研究,其損失更大。花費大量人力、物力、財力的勘探開發工程,取得的地質資料不完整,或者電子文件讀不出來,或數據信息是錯的,後果是嚴重的。地質科技文件材料與數據產生後,即需標明責任者,電子文件就該及時賦予標識,防止修改,防止刪除,並附有背景說明。
(二)可優化管理,提高管理效率
傳統的地質資料管理,其前端是對歸檔的地質科技文件材料進行整理、編號、標識、入庫。歸檔前的地質科技文件材料管理沒有進入全程管理的視野,也無章法可循,一般由地質科技人員或工程技術人員保管,對質量也無規范性要求。實施前端控制後,使整個地質資料管理成了一個體系,標准、規范一貫到底,不但與工程施工、實驗分析、數據處理、地質研究環環緊密相扣,還能促成地質資料管理業務流程一體化,減少乃至消除地質資料歸檔前、歸檔後的管理管理環節疏漏或重復,達到功能合理,效率更高的效果。
現在的工程設備上地質資料的產生,大多為機出資料,自動列印。也有人工記錄,如施工班報、生產日報等,但人工記錄也都是計算機製作相關文字和報表。在文件形成的同時,將文件內容進行描述、文件結構、背景、版本、數據生成環境、存在狀態等方面的信息進行採集。如鑽井的基礎數據,文字性資料的著錄項等,這些數據是一次採集,全程使用。這種方法可以避免在地質資料歸檔著錄時的重復採集及其由於二次或多次數據採集輸入而出現的出錯概率。
以前地質資料管理部門,對前端產生了哪些地質資料,什麼時間應該歸檔心中無數,質量評判也缺乏依據。實行前端控制後,對產生的地質資料的數量和質量參與了控制,可以及時調劑利用和通知入館歸檔。